Queensday is the biggest Dutch party day of the year, it's always held on the 30th of April. The reason why it's called Queensday is because it was the ex Queen Julianas birthday.

Everyone dresses up in Organge, since that is the last name of the Royal family. Everyone is allowed to sell whatever they want......when it comes to things....so there are some restrictions when it comes to food and drink. Children sell old toys or arrange games that people have to pay for to try. Or they sell lemonade or performe dance performances etc. For the adults there are concerts all over the country, beer tents and in our village the have things like jack russel raceses and horse and carriage "games". It is a lot of fun, even if it is bad weather people smile :)
